So my MRI enterography came back normal. My mom still thinks it’s my gallbladder and I think I’m beginning to think of it as well. I’m trying to get a ultrasound of it and then see someone involving the muscles in that area. Has anyone with IBD had their gallbladder out as well?

      Yes I’m Claire, 18 year old diagnosed with Crohn’s at age 11. In 2020 I had my gallbladder removed because it was completely filled with stones and I was in a crap ton of pain. The doctors said that it was a complication due to my Crohn’s diagnoses. However I would like you to know that most doctors give a talk when you are about to get it out, and it can be hard to hear for people with eating disorders or weight issues. I was completely taken aback by the fact that my doctor called me severely obese and that was really hurtful because I had just lost 60 pounds and was in recovery from an ed. Also a side affect of not having one can be weight gain which is the biggest one I’ve had to deal with. Good luck with your journey and if you have more questions please feel free to ask💕
